2012-04-05 15 views
1

いくつかのExcelファイルを読み込むパーサーを実行しようとしています。私はすべての上位要素の合計を見つける行の一番下に値が必要です。だからセルの値は実際には "= sum()"または "A5 * 0.5"と言うことができます。このファイルを開くと、このファイルはExcelのように見えます。しかし、ws.cell(x、y).valueでこの値を読み込もうとすると、何も得られません。xlrdを使って数式を読む方法

私の質問は、ws.cell(x、y).valueなどのように読むことができる場合、xlrdでこの種のフィールドを読み取る方法です。

感謝

あなたの質問へのリンクを1として
+0

このリンクはあなたにガイドラインを提供する必要があります:http:// stackoverflow。 com/questions/4690423/get-formula-from-excel-cell-with-python-xlrd –

答えて

0

は、私は上記の投稿した、xlrdの著者は言う、進行中の仕事がある 『』が、xlrdの焦点としてすぐに利用可能である可能性が高いではありません注:これは2011年1月の著者のコメントに基づいています。

+0

afaicr excelは式とともに現在の値を保存しますので、式を評価できなくても値を取得できるはずです – serbaut

+0

リファレンス:http:// stackov erflow.com/questions/4690423/get-formula-from-excel-cell-with-python-xlrd – Mermoz

関連する問題